Tengo la mejor VPN 0€ en casa (¡y tú también puedes!)

Tengo la mejor VPN 0€ en casa (¡y tú también puedes!)

How to Access Your Home Network Remotely Using Tailscale

Introduction to Remote Access

  • The video discusses the utility of accessing home networks remotely, particularly in scenarios involving public Wi-Fi or sharing streaming services with family members.
  • It highlights the need for secure access to devices like NAS or media servers (Plex, Jellyfin) without compromising security by opening router ports.

Overview of Tailscale VPN

  • Tailscale is introduced as a user-friendly VPN solution that requires no complex configurations or port openings.
  • The speaker emphasizes installing Tailscale on various devices within the home network for seamless communication and safety.

Device Compatibility and Setup

  • Tailscale can be installed on multiple operating systems and devices, including Windows computers and Apple TVs, although these may not be ideal due to power management issues.
  • A Raspberry Pi is recommended for installation due to its low power consumption and ease of setup; models 3, 4, or 5 are suitable.

Requirements for Installation

  • To set up Tailscale, users will need a Raspberry Pi (preferably model 5), a micro USB card, and potentially a USB reader if their computer lacks one.
  • The speaker notes that Tailscale is free for up to three users and 100 devices, making it accessible for personal use.

Step-by-Step Installation Process

  • The video promises a straightforward step-by-step guide on installing Raspbian OS on the Raspberry Pi using an application called Raspberry Pi Imager.

How to Set Up SSH and VNC on Raspberry Pi

Activating SSH and Preparing the MicroSD Card

  • The process begins by activating SSH with password authentication on the second tab of the configuration. After enabling it, save changes and confirm overwriting the microSD card.
  • Once saved, allow a few minutes for recording and verification on the microSD card before removing it from the reader.

Connecting Raspberry Pi to Network

  • Insert the microSD card into the Raspberry Pi, connect a network cable (preferably wired), and power it on. This initial boot may take several minutes.
  • To find the IP address of your Raspberry Pi, use a terminal command ping followed by its hostname (e.g., vpnTailscale.local). Alternatively, check your router's HTTP configuration.

Accessing Raspberry Pi via SSH

  • Use SSH to access your device by entering ssh followed by your username and IP address. Input the previously set password to log in.
  • Enable VNC by typing sudo raspi-config, navigating to interface options, selecting VNC, and confirming its activation.

Installing VNC Client

  • Download a VNC client like RealVNC for Windows; installation is straightforward.
  • In the VNC client, input your Raspberry Pi's IP address to connect. Enter your configured username and password when prompted.

Configuring Static IP Address

  • It’s recommended to configure a static IP for easier access. Edit connections under Wired Connection 1 in IPv4 settings; switch from DHCP to manual configuration.
  • Choose an appropriate static IP outside of your DHCP range (e.g., 192.168.0.x), set subnet mask (255.255.255.0), and gateway as your router's IP before saving changes.

Setting Up TailScale VPN

  • Create a free user account on TailScale using services like Google for easy login.
  • Install TailScale client on Raspberry Pi by copying provided commands into terminal; this will initiate installation after hitting Enter.

Authenticating Device with TailScale

  • Post-installation, run sudo tailscale app which generates an authentication URL for logging into TailScale via browser.

Configuring Subnet Router in TailScale

  • Configure Subnet Router within TailScale allowing local network exposure to connected clients—enabling access to devices like NAS or Plex remotely.

Finalizing Routing Configuration

  • Execute specific commands shown in terminal for routing setup within local network through TailScale.

How to Configure TailScale on Raspberry Pi

Setting Up IP Range and Client Configuration

  • The user must input their specific IP range, commonly in the format 192.168.x.x/24, which can be found in the router's configuration.
  • It's crucial to configure or accept settings in the TailScale administration panel; otherwise, they won't function properly.
  • Users should enable subnet routing by editing root settings in the TailScale admin panel to expose local networks to connected clients.

Configuring Raspberry Pi as an Exit Node

  • To allow traffic through the Raspberry Pi as an internet output node, execute the command sudo tailscale set-advertise-exit-node once.
  • After executing the command, return to the TailScale console and enable the node as an exit node via route configuration.

Finalizing VPN Configuration

  • It is recommended to disable key expiry for convenience, preventing frequent re-authentication issues from occurring within the TailScale admin panel.

Connecting Additional Devices (Android Example)

  • Install the TailScale app from Play Store on Android devices and grant permission for VPN management before logging into your account.
  • Once connected, users can access their local network even while using mobile data (5G), demonstrating seamless integration with existing networks.

Managing Traffic and Security Features

  • Users can switch between different exit nodes without advanced settings, allowing them to control their internet traffic location easily.
  • The TailScale administration console provides comprehensive device management options including activity logs and user invitations for up to two additional accounts on a free plan.

Key Benefits of Using TailScale

  • Accessing home resources securely is vital for protecting personal files and documents stored at home.
Video description

Te enseño a instalar una VPN para tu casa de forma super sencilla: podrás navegar de forma segura cuando estás en una red wifi pública, acceder a tus servicios privados o incluso poder compartir con amigos y familiares servicios de streaming. Vamos a instalar TailScale, sin ningún coste. No tendrás que tener grandes conocimientos técnicos, vamos a ir paso a paso. ✅ Toda la información de los productos del vídeo: ► Raspberry Pi 5 en Amazon: https://unloco.link/YZisF ► Raspberry Pi 5 en Aliexpress: https://unloco.link/TAeb1 ► Raspberry Pi 5 en Amazon 🇺🇸: https://unloco.link/HI1Ut ► Lector Micro SD a USB: https://unloco.link/EpQjo 🔴 Tienda de domótica en Amazon: https://www.amazon.es/shop/unlocoysutecnologia ⚡ Apúntate a la newsletter del canal y recibe consejos y trucos: https://unloco.link/newsletter Blog: https://unlocoysutecnologia.com/tengo-la-mejor-vpn-0e-para-casa-y-tu-tambien-puedes/ 🔴 Tienda de domótica en Amazon: https://www.amazon.es/shop/unlocoysutecnologia 👍 🅳🅰🅻🅴 🅻🅸🅺🅴 🅰🅻 🆅🅸🅳🅴🅾 🚀 // 👍 𝗔𝗣𝗢𝗬𝗔 𝗔𝗟 𝗖𝗔𝗡𝗔𝗟 🛑 Puedes 𝗶𝗻𝘃𝗶𝘁𝗮𝗿𝗺𝗲 a un café: https://www.buymeacoffee.com/ccorderor 🛑 Puedes convertirte en miembro del canal en Youtube: https://www.youtube.com/channel/UC2zp7AWsYhZaGmYTjP8hZ7A/join 🛑 o puedes hacerlo en Patreon: https://www.patreon.com/unlocoysutecnologia 💥 𝗦𝗨𝗦𝗖𝗥𝗜𝗕𝗘𝗧𝗘 𝗔𝗟 𝗖𝗔𝗡𝗔𝗟 𝗬 𝗗𝗔𝗟𝗘 𝗔 𝗟𝗔 𝗖𝗔𝗠𝗣𝗔𝗡𝗜𝗧𝗔. 𝗚𝗥𝗔𝗖𝗜𝗔𝗦! 💥 ⚡ 𝗧𝗘𝗟𝗘𝗚𝗥𝗔𝗠 ► https://t.me/unlocoysutecnologia 📱 𝗧𝗜𝗞𝗧𝗢𝗞 ► https://www.tiktok.com/@unlocoysutecnologia 📸 𝗜𝗡𝗦𝗧𝗔𝗚𝗥𝗔𝗠 ► https://instagram.com/unlocoysutecnologia ==== OTROS VÍDEOS DEL CANAL ==== Todo sobre TailScale: https://youtu.be/3z2iNte6gpE Instalar Home Assistant en Raspberry Pi 5: https://youtu.be/PckogX_lHwc Te recomiendo que veas estos vídeos para entender algunos conceptos: 🔝 Scheduler para Home Assistant - https://youtu.be/vHttIXo3GmQ 🔝 Migramos a Z-Wave JS - https://youtu.be/avd0EpMNGlk 🔝 ¿Cómo actualizar Home Assistant? - https://youtu.be/lk3IrUyh7nk 🔝 Instalación de HACS en Home Assistant - https://youtu.be/4-uJjhKU8CE 🔝 Home Assistant Cloud - https://youtu.be/bb-obCABcvc 🔝 Conectar Node-Red y Home Assistant - https://youtu.be/sIvzWJ4ytok #vpn #gratis #facil